Praxium Mastery Academy serves 136 students in grades 6-12.
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 50-54% (which is higher than the Idaho state average of 41%).
The student-teacher ratio of 27:1 is higher than the Idaho state level of 17:1.
Minority enrollment is 21%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Idaho state average of 28% (majority Hispanic).

Praxium Mastery Academy's student population of 136 students has declined by 34% over five school years.
The teacher population of 5 teachers has declined by 50% over five school years.
